Developer access

From MediaWiki.org
Jump to: navigation, search
Join the MediaWiki development community

Thanks for joining the MediaWiki development community. By doing so, you gain access to two important tools:

  • Gerrit is the tool that we use for reviewing code contributions to our Git repositories before merging them into the main branch. You'll need to familiarize yourself with the Git and Gerrit workflow to submit changes.
  • Wikimedia Labs is an environment used for staging and testing code and services. You'll get an account on Labs, but you'll need to be added to specific projects before you can do anything there.

The centralized accounts (LDAP) are managed from the Wikimedia Labs console (more information).

You must have an account on this wiki (create one here - a recently-created Wikipedia account or other account on a Wikimedia project would also work here) and be logged in to post a request for an account. To post a request for a developer account, add a comment on this page with:

  • Preferred Git username - Alphanumeric; will also be your Git commit author name, so your full name or wiki username would be reasonable. This will be permanent, so choose wisely, and leave out things like organization names or other current affiliations.
  • Your svn account name if you have one, or if you didn't, your preferred shell username. Shell account names should start with a lower-case letter, followed by 1 to 16 numbers, lower case ASCII letters or - (hyphen-minus) characters. (regex: [a-z_][-a-z0-9]*) Shell account names can be the same as your username, if your username fits these guidelines.
  • Did you previously have a svn.wikimedia.org account? (Yes/No)
  • Your preferred email address This must be an email address. (not [[special:emailuser]]!) Your email address will be easily accessible to (and not obfuscated) all other labs users.

And then someone with the relevant privileges will create an account for you. Check back here to see whether it's been done, then do your initial login.

If you don't want to post a public request, you can privately email User:Sumanah and give her the information above to get an account, but it will take longer.

By requesting an account in Labs, you are agreeing to the Labs terms of service.

Prior to March 2012, Wikimedia used Subversion as its version control system. The commit access process for Subversion is archived here: Developer access/Subversion


Contents

[edit] Requests

An archive box Archives 

Archive

[edit] User:YaoJungang

Preferred git username
yaojungang
Preferred shell username
y109
Did you previously have SVN access?
No
Email address
[email protected]

Requested by: --http://y109.jzland.com (talk) 06:41, 10 October 2012 (UTC)


[edit] User:Kitchen Knife

Preferred git username
Kitchen Knif
Preferred shell username
Kitchen Knif
Did you previously have SVN access?
No
Email address
[email protected]

Requested by: --Kitchen Knife (talk) 21:42, 22 October 2012 (UTC)--Irate (talk) 21:39, 22 October 2012 (UTC)

My intention is to lobby for a roll back https://gerrit.wikimedia.org/r/#/c/25412/ so that the bugs introduced by the deliberate removal of feature is reversed.--Kitchen Knife (talk) 21:42, 22 October 2012 (UTC)--Irate (talk) 21:39, 22 October 2012 (UTC)

Hi, Irate, also known as Kitchen Knife. Your shell username cannot include spaces and all the letters have to be lowercase. May I suggest "kitchenknif"? Thanks. Sharihareswara (WMF) (talk) 22:10, 22 October 2012 (UTC)

[edit] User:Ori.livneh

Preferred git username
GerritWebClient
Preferred shell username
gwclient
Did you previously have SVN access?
No
Email address
[email protected]

Requested by: --ori (talk) 20:37, 6 November 2012 (UTC)

I'm developing a small set of friendly web interfaces around the Gerrit JSON-RPC API, and I'd like a separate account to use for accessing it. It should have the standard permission level for new users. My personal Gerrit username is ori.livneh. If there are specific naming conventions for non-human Gerrit accounts, feel free to override my preferences and choose a different set of usernames. Thanks!

[edit] User:Superm401

Preferred git username
mattflaschen
Preferred shell username
mattflaschen
Did you previously have SVN access?
No
Email address
[email protected]

Requested by: --Superm401 - Talk 03:21, 10 November 2012 (UTC)

Yes check.svg Account created. siebrand (talk) 05:52, 10 November 2012 (UTC)

[edit] User:Sundar

Preferred git username
sundar
Preferred shell username
sundar
Did you previously have SVN access?
No
Email address
sundarbecse at yahoo dot com

Requested by: --Sundar (talk) 04:59, 10 November 2012 (UTC)

X mark.svg Not done Duplicate request. Already had "oligoglot" created. siebrand (talk) 06:16, 10 November 2012 (UTC)

[edit] User:Jbk malkum

Preferred git username
jbk_malkum
Preferred shell username
malkum
Did you previously have SVN access?
No
Email address
[email protected]

Requested by: --Jbk malkum (talk) 06:00, 10 November 2012 (UTC)

X mark.svg Not done It looks like this was a duplicate request, as labs:User:Malkum was created 3 days ago. siebrand (talk) 06:11, 10 November 2012 (UTC)
Indeed. Resolved. siebrand (talk) 06:14, 10 November 2012 (UTC)

[edit] User:Swaroopsm

Preferred git username
swaroopsm
Preferred shell username
swaroopsm
Did you previously have SVN access?
No
Email address
[email protected]

Requested by: --Swaroopsm (talk) 06:05, 10 November 2012 (UTC)

Yes check.svg Account created. siebrand (talk) 06:12, 10 November 2012 (UTC)
Personal tools
Namespaces

Variants
Actions
Navigation
Support
Download
Development
Communication
Print/export
Toolbox